The Yii2 framework is famous for its performance and has many users. Sometimes our projects may require multi-language support, so how to configure the language pack of Yii2? Let’s set up the language pack of Yii2 today.

The multi-language version of yii2 is almost similar to yii1

1. Set the default language: Add: 'language'=>'zh-CN'

# to the mail.php configuration file ##2. Multi-language switching


<a href="<?php echo Yii::$app->urlManager->createUrl([&#39;/ebay/user/language&#39;,&#39;lang&#39;=>&#39;zh-CN&#39;]);?>">中文</a>  
<a href="<?php echo Yii::$app->urlManager->createUrl([&#39;/ebay/user/language&#39;,&#39;lang&#39;=>&#39;en&#39;]);?>">英文</a>

controller code:

///语言切换 
public function actionLanguage(){       
    $language=  \Yii::$app->request->get(&#39;lang&#39;);  
    if(isset($language)){  
        \Yii::$app->session[&#39;language&#39;]=$language;  
    }  
    //切换完语言哪来的返回到哪里
    $this->goBack(\Yii::$app->request->headers[&#39;Referer&#39;]);  
}
